Cryogenic Engineer
A cryogenic engineer works on projects that use cryogens, which are extremely cold substances used in various industrial and scientific applications. They apply their knowledge of thermodynamics and cryogenics to design, build, and maintain cryogenic systems. These systems can be used in a range of settings, such as medical imaging, high-energy physics, and aerospace engineering. Cryogenic engineers may also be involved in developing new cryogenic technologies and materials.
